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Overview
The global Commercial Clothes Dryer Market size estimated at USD 481.84 million in 2026 and is projected to reach USD 2541.29 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 26.81% from 2026 to 2035.
The Commercial Clothes Dryer Market is expanding due to rising installation of industrial laundry systems across hotels, hospitals, laundromats, and manufacturing units. More than 68% of industrial laundries upgraded to automated drying systems between 2021 and 2025. Gas-powered dryers account for nearly 57% of total commercial installations because of lower operating costs and drying cycles under 35 minutes. Stainless steel drum adoption exceeded 61% in heavy-duty systems due to corrosion resistance and durability exceeding 12 years. Smart control integration increased by 44% in commercial dryers with IoT-enabled diagnostics. Energy-efficient models reduced electricity consumption by nearly 28% compared to conventional dryers manufactured before 2019.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Analysis indicates increasing demand from hospitality facilities with occupancy rates above 70%.
The USA Commercial Clothes Dryer Market remains dominant due to widespread laundromat infrastructure and institutional laundry operations. The United States accounted for approximately 31% of commercial laundry equipment installations in 2025. More than 35,000 laundromat facilities operate across the country, with over 72% using high-capacity dryers above 15 kg. Gas-based commercial dryers represent nearly 64% of installed systems due to lower energy costs in industrial operations. Hotel laundry outsourcing increased by 41% between 2022 and 2025, driving demand for centralized drying facilities. Healthcare institutions in the USA process over 5.5 billion pounds of laundry annually, creating strong demand for industrial drying systems with cycle times below 40 minutes and moisture sensors improving efficiency by 26%.

By Type
<10kg: Commercial dryers below 10 kg capacity represent approximately 19% of the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Share. These units are widely used in compact laundromats, salons, gyms, and small hospitality facilities. Nearly 61% of small commercial establishments prefer dryers below 10 kg due to lower installation requirements and energy consumption reductions of nearly 18%. Electric-powered models dominate this category with approximately 72% penetration because of easier installation in urban commercial buildings.
10-15kg: The 10-15 kg category accounts for nearly 33% of the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Size due to its balanced operational capacity and moderate energy consumption. Approximately 57% of medium-scale laundromats utilize dryers within this range because they can process between 60 and 85 laundry loads per day. Gas-powered systems hold around 54% share in this segment owing to faster drying cycles averaging below 38 minutes. Smart monitoring systems integrated into mid-capacity dryers increased operational efficiency by 26%.
>15kg: Dryers above 15 kg dominate the Commercial Clothes Dryer Market with approximately 48% market share. Industrial laundries, hospitals, and large hotels account for nearly 69% of installations in this category. High-capacity dryers process more than 120 laundry loads daily and reduce labor requirements by approximately 31%. Gas-based systems represent around 63% of this segment because of lower operational costs during large-volume processing. Automated chemical injection compatibility and programmable cycles increased productivity by 28%.
By Application
Laundry industry: The laundry industry contributes approximately 44% of total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Share, making it the largest application segment. More than 35,000 laundromat facilities globally upgraded commercial dryers between 2022 and 2025. Automated dryers reduced processing times by nearly 29% and improved operational throughput by approximately 33%. Coin-operated laundry facilities increasingly adopted stackable dryers, improving space utilization by 27%. Gas-powered industrial dryers account for nearly 58% of laundromat installations due to lower operating costs.
Enterprise Factory: Enterprise factories represent around 11% of the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Size. Manufacturing facilities processing uniforms, protective garments, and industrial textiles require continuous drying operations exceeding 10 hours daily. Nearly 46% of enterprise factories upgraded to automated dryers with programmable settings between 2023 and 2025. Stainless steel drums dominate this segment with approximately 71% adoption because of exposure to chemicals and heavy-duty textile loads. Industrial dryers reduced garment turnaround times by nearly 24% in large-scale production facilities.
Medical industry: The medical industry accounts for nearly 14% of Commercial Clothes Dryer Market demand due to rising hospital linen processing requirements. Healthcare institutions process over 5 billion pounds of laundry annually worldwide, with drying temperatures exceeding 70°C necessary for sanitation compliance. Approximately 64% of hospitals prefer industrial dryers above 15 kg capacity for continuous operation. Moisture sensing and antimicrobial coating technologies reduced bacterial contamination risks by nearly 22%.
Bath industry: The bath industry contributes around 10% of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Share due to high towel and linen processing volumes in spas, wellness centers, and public bath facilities. Approximately 52% of bath industry operators upgraded dryers between 2022 and 2025 to improve energy efficiency. Compact commercial dryers below 15 kg account for nearly 61% of installations because of moderate operational volumes. Automated drying systems reduced towel processing times by approximately 18% and minimized textile shrinkage rates by 12%.
Hotel: Hotels account for nearly 21% of Commercial Clothes Dryer Market demand because of rising occupancy rates and increasing tourism infrastructure. More than 68% of hotels with over 100 rooms operate centralized laundry facilities equipped with dryers above 15 kg capacity. Automated dryers improved linen turnover efficiency by approximately 32% while reducing labor requirements by 19%. Hospitality chains increasingly adopted IoT-connected dryers capable of remote monitoring and predictive maintenance. Commercial Clothes Dryer Market Trends show that hotel laundries process between 800 and 2,500 pounds of linens daily depending on property size.
